Instructions

  1. Prepare Your Workstation: Line a baking sheet with parchment or wax paper. Insert wooden sticks gently into each marshmallow about halfway to ensure they stand upright for easy dipping.
  2. Melt the Plant-Based Chocolate: Slowly melt plant-based ch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l or double boiler, stirring frequently to maintain a smooth, glossy texture ideal for coating.
  3. Dip the Marshmallows: Hold each marshmallow by the stick and dip it into the melted chocolate, turning to coat evenly. Let any excess chocolate drip off before placing on the prepared baking sheet.
  4. Add Toppings: While the chocolate is still wet, sprinkle your chosen toppings such as nuts, sprinkles, or coconut flakes so they stick well to the coating.
  5. Let Them Set: Refrigerate the baking sheet with the dipped pops for 15-20 minutes or until the coating firms up, producing a satisfying snap when bitten.

Notes

  • Slowly melt chocolate to keep it smooth and shiny without clumping.
  • Insert sticks carefully to avoid puncturing through the marshmallow’s opposite end.
  • Use fresh toppings like nuts or coconut flakes for best crunch and flavor.
  • Refrigerate pops immediately after decorating to preserve shape and texture.
  • Store pops in an airtight container at room temperature to avoid moisture softening the coating.
